1920 London (2016) is the third installment in the popular 1920 horror franchise, known for blending supernatural elements with intense drama and, at times, romantic or "hot" scenes that raise the tension. While the film, featuring Sharman Joshi and Meera Chopra, garnered a mixed reception from critics, it drew significant attention for its atmosphere and specific scenes, often searched for on platforms like Filmyzilla.

remains a highly searched online query for users seeking to stream or download the 2016 Bollywood supernatural horror film 1920 London . Directed by Tinu Suresh Desai and penned by the veteran master of Indian horror, Vikram Bhatt, the film serves as the third installment in the popular 1920 film franchise.

Despite—or perhaps because of—its critical drubbing, 1920 London has found a niche audience among fans of "so-bad-it's-good" cinema. The film's unintentionally hilarious moments, absurd plot twists (including the appearance of a "telekinetic lemon," as one critic pointed out), and over-the-top performances have made it a cult curiosity for some horror enthusiasts.
